1. INTRODUCTION
1.1 PRECAUTIONS, REQUIREMENTS, RECOMMENDATIONS
Read the documentation carefully, install and use the equipment according to the specifications, and follow all the safety regulations in order to
ensure proper and safe use of the device. Any use that is incompatible with these instructions can cause serious injuries. Restrict access by
unauthorized persons and train the operational personnel. The term operational personnel refers to people who are suitably trained and have
appropriate experience and knowledge of relevant norms, documentation and occupational health and safety regulations, and are authorized to
conduct the required work and can identify possible threats and avoid them. This operation and maintenance manual, which is delivered with
the device, includes detailed information on all possible configurations of the heaters, examples of their assembly, start, use, repair and
maintenance. To operate this device correctly, this manual includes instructions sufficient for qualified personnel. The documentation should be
placed close to the device for ease of access by the service team. The manufacturer reserves the right to introduce changes to the manual or
the specifications of the device, which may alter its operation, without prior notice. VTS America Inc. shall not be held liable for current
maintenance, servicing, programming, damage caused by standstill of the device awaiting warranty service, any damage to customer’s
possessions other than the device, or faults resulting from the wrong assembly or use of the device.

1.3 INITIAL STEPS TAKEN BEFORE THE INSTALLATION
Record the serial number of the device in the warranty card, prior to the commencement of the installation process. It is required to properly
fill-in the warranty card, after the completion of the assembly. Prior to the commencing of any installation or maintenance work, it is required
to disconnect power supply and protect it against unintentional activation.
2. STRUCTURE, INTENDED USE, PRINCIPLE OF OPERATION
2.1 INTENDED USE
VOLCANO VR has been designed to ensure ease of use and optimum performance.
The device is available in fife versions:
• VOLCANO VR Mini (10-68 MBH, 1236 CFM)
• VOLCANO VR 1 (17-102 MBH, 3119 CFM)
• VOLCANO VR 2 (27-170 MBH, 2855 CFM)
• VOLCANO VR 3 (44-256 MBH, 3355 CFM)
• VOLCANO VR-D (3826 CFM)
• VOLCANO VR-D Mini (1371 CFM)
VOLCANO combines state-of-the-art technology, innovative design and high effectiveness. Unique technical solutions such as the design of the
heat exchanger, improved fan and increased range of air stream, allow the VOLCANO heater to achieve optimal heating power, perfect for the
size and type of room. APPLICATION: production halls, warehouses, wholesale outlets, sports facilities, greenhouses, supermarkets, church
buildings, farm buildings, workshops, health care facilities, pharmacies, hospitals. MAIN ADVANTAGES: high effectiveness, low maintenance
costs, full parameter control, easy and quick assembly.
2.2 PRINCIPLE OF OPERATION
The heating medium (hot water) gives up heat to the heat exchanger using a highly developed heat exchanger, ensuring great heating power
(Volcano VR Mini – 10-68 MBH, VR 1 – 17-102 MBH, VR 2 – 27-170 MBH, VR 3 – 44-256 MBH). A highly effective axial fan (674-3355 m
3
/h)
draws air in from the room, pumps it through the heat exchanger and then sends it back into the room.
Volcano VR-D de-stratifies the heated air from the sub-ceiling zone to the above-ground zone. Hot air exhaust results in a leveling of the
temperature gradient in particular air layers and contributes to reducing the costs of heating by lowering the temperature in the ceiling zone,
thus limiting heat loss through the roof. The VOLCANO VR-D de-stratifier will be the most effective in combination with VR Mini, VR1, VR2 and
VR3 air heaters. Cooperation of both of these device types will allow for achieving optimal temperature comfort fast due to the support of the
heating system through more efficient distribution of hot air.
